* Na₂CO₃: This represents one molecule of sodium carbonate.
* 2Na₂CO₃: This indicates that we have two molecules of sodium carbonate.
Breakdown:
* Sodium (Na): There are 2 sodium atoms per molecule, and we have 2 molecules, so there are 2 * 2 = 4 sodium atoms
* Carbon (C): There is 1 carbon atom per molecule, and we have 2 molecules, so there are 1 * 2 = 2 carbon atoms
* Oxygen (O): There are 3 oxygen atoms per molecule, and we have 2 molecules, so there are 3 * 2 = 6 oxygen atoms
Therefore, in 2Na₂CO₃, there are:
* 4 sodium atoms
* 2 carbon atoms
* 6 oxygen atoms
